Ingredients

The following ingredients have 4 Servings
  • 1-3/4 cups self-rising flour (plus more for rolling)
  • 3 ounces sharp cheddar cheese (grated)
  • 1/2 cup creamed corn
  • 3/4 cup heavy cream
  • 1/2 teaspoon granulated garlic
  • 7-8 slices picked jalapenos (finely diced)
  • 1-2 Tablespoons butter, melted (optional)

Instruction

  • Toss cheese with flour.
  • Add cream, corn and garlic until well blended.
  • Stir in jalapenos.
  • Roll on floured surface to about 3/4 inch thickness, using a floured rolling pin and lightly dusting the surface of the dough with flour.
  • Cut with biscuit cutter, using straight down and up motion.
  • Place on baking sheet lined with parchment paper very closely together, but not touching. 
  • Bake at 425 degrees 12-15 minutes, or until light golden color. 
  • Brush with melted butter after removing from oven, if desired.
